EDIT: Review - After having this for about 3 months now, I can say it is one of the best cases available. If you're needing absolute protection for your investment, you should look into getting one of these; just as long as you don't mind the extra bulk.
Polycarbonate materials make it virtually indestructable; I've actually thrown mine against a brick wall a few times and all that resulted from it were a few scratches. The rubber lining inside the actual case act as pretty good shock absorbers so you don't really have to worry if you drop your PSP on concrete or other hard surfaces.
Design wise it leaves openings for your PSP's power button, left & right triggers for when you are listening to music and need control, memory stick duo slot for easy swapping of memory sticks, and also the charging port and headphone jack. You can also customise your PGP with skins that can be downloaded and printed off from the net - you can create your own using templates and you can also download the template and print it, then use it to cut out stuff from magazines/books etc to create a funky skin of your own.
One bad thing I found about the PGP is that the rubber inserts do tend to get loose and if you're playing your PSP with the shield part of the PGP on an angle, the rubber insert does tend to fall out. However that is easily fixed by applying a little water onto the insert and rubbing it in firmly to the polycarbonate part of the PGP.
All in all it is well worth the money, although you do look like a bit of a geek with it - I would rather have my PSP in one piece and look like a geek, than having a broken PSP and using the soft case that was supplied with the PSP Value Pack.
5 out 5 rating from me.

i already own one of these baby's, came with the Logitech Playgear Collection which included: PlayGear Pocket, 2 x PlayGear Stealth, PlayGear Share, Wrist Strap with attachable LCD Cleaning Cloth, Special Edition Gift Box. It is coming out in Oz soon so get it if you can, i got it off ebay.
